Abstract: This study is an attempt to develop a decision-making support systern for maintenance management of existing concrete bridges based on life cycle analysis. In this study, the durability and load-carrying capability are applied as the respective main indexes of performance for bridge members so as to clarifj the difference between repairs and strengthening measures. A repair is assumed to affect the deterioration of durability, whereas strengthening is assumed to affect the deterioration of load-carrying capability. The deterioration curve is presented as a method of estimating the progressive deterioration of performance on existing bridge members. This proposed system enables not only the evaluation of bridge performance, but also the suggestion of some strategies based on a combination of maintenance cost minimization and quality maximization approach.
